A CASIX LDC-1500 is a precision laser diode controller engineered for laboratory and industrial environments, providing stable and accurate current and temperature regulation for laser diodes. This controller is designed to ensure optimal laser diode performance and extend operational lifespan. It features a user-friendly interface and incorporates comprehensive protection mechanisms, making it a suitable choice for applications requiring precise laser diode control.
